[信息技术]《数学中与循环》VB程序设计教学案例.doc

[信息技术]《数学中与循环》VB程序设计教学案例.doc

  1. 1、本文档共5页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
[信息技术]《数学中与循环》VB程序设计教学案例

[信息技术]《数学中与循环》VB程序设计教学案例 课标分析 程序设计中的循环结构是本章的最后一个知识点,这是要求学生能正确理解和掌握的程序设计中的三种基本结构之一,要求学生能根据具体问题选用适当的结构语句。培养学生将实际问题转化成计算机处理问题的能力和逻辑思维能力。本节课的一个重要环节是在教学中展现循环结构中数学领域的具体应用。使学生在解决实际问题的过程中,体会程序设计的乐趣。 教材分析 本节课内容是普通高中课程标准实验教材《算法与程序设计》(选修)第二章第三节的第三环节内容。本节课涉及到循环结构的基本流程图和循环语句的使用。通过本节课学习,使学生进一步感受和体验计算机编程技术给生活和和学习带来的便利。为今后第三章《算法的程序实现》和第四章《程序设计思想和方法》的理论学习打下良好的实践基础。 学情与学法分析 学生在前一阶段已经学习了VB基本知识以及计算机表示与数学表示的异同。并学习了顺序、选择两种基本结构。但在应用方面有待提高。 我将通过创设问题情境,让学生经历:创设怀境,提出问题→启发思考,分析问题,建构问题解决流程→布置分层任务,引导问题解决→程序调试与提高→巩固与知识的迁移的一个基本过程。逐步完成知识的建构,获得知识并形成一个良好的逻辑思维习惯。 教学方法与教学手段 针对上述情况我将采用启发引导为主的教学方法、运用幻灯片展示等方法调动学生积极性,激发学生学习的兴趣。 教学要点 ⑴知识与技能:掌握循环结构语句的使用格式,学会用结构化方法解决数学问题。⑵过程与方法:设置问题情景,启发学生的逻辑思考能力,提出问题解决方案,在过程中培养学生的逻辑思维能力和勇于探索精神。 ⑶情感、态度与价值观:通过激发学生思维,培养学生自主寻找在学习其它学科中的结构化解决问题的方法、意识,提高学生对信息技术在其它学科中作用的认识。 重点:掌握循环执行的程序基本结构。 难点:解决问题是如何恰当地选择循环变量;编写程序时如何确定循环体部分;循环语句的选择。 教学过程 环节 教师活动 学生活动 教学意图 创设怀境,提出问题 教师提问:老师遇到这样一个问题,请大家利用所学过的知识面帮助老师解决:一球从100米高度自由落下,每次落地后又反跳回原高度的一半,再落下,求宏观世界在第10次落地时,共经过多少米?第10次反弹多高? 情况一:将其转化成数学中的数列进行计算; 情况二:利用计算机中的计算器计算; 情况三:不会做; 情况四:这是一个物理问题,要用物理立法解决。 …… 了解学生对数学的这部分知识的掌握程度,掌握好的可以很好地理解循环结构,掌握得不令人满意的需加以引导。 启发思考,分析问题 教师提问1:有部分同学对问题的回答一部分是正确的。如用数列进行计算;用VB编程解决。题目给出的是一个等比数列:100、50、25……但我们如何才能将数列与VB编程完美结合,实现我们的设想呢? 学生看书并进行思考与讨论。结果是:①表达不清;②思考不到;③部分各自完成,不讨论 逐步引导学生进入问题的情境,并引导学生逐步形成一个逻辑思维的习惯 教师提问2:其实,我们可以想一想,在这个问题中,重复出现的是什么动作?一共多少次?每两次之间的差是多少呢? 自由落下动作与求和;共10 次;每两次之间的差是1。 1.引导学生在观察中学习,在学习中观察。 2.培养学生的关联学习能力,以达到培养他们举一反三的能力。 教师提问3:我们用变量i表示自由落下的动作次数;初始高度用常量h=100表示;用变量sum表示共经过的路程。那么sum与i的关系我们可以用一个什么表达式进行描述?我们可以用一个怎样的图来表示我们的计算过程?(给出电子板书一) 学生给出: Sum=h+1/(i*2)h+1/(i*2*2)h…… 学生画图,但都没有能正确表达出题意。 根据学生的反应引出循环语句的概念、格式、功能和流程图(给出电子板书二), 请问大家:老师刚才所说的几个量中,哪一个是循环变量?它的初值和终值是多少?步长是多少?循环体部分应该是哪一个呢? 学生领会循环结构思想。有的看书;有的做笔记;有的玩小动作。 学生回答老师提问:i 是循环变量;初值和终值分别是1和10;步长是1;循环体部分应该是求和部分。 布置分层任务 引导问题解决 A层(较差学生):比较电子板书一和电子板书二,写出本题的程序流程图; B层(能力较好的学生):画出本题流程图,并试写出主要程序部分。 学生埋头画图。A层学生很少画出,B层学生大部分画出流程图,半数以上B层学生写出主要程序的几句。 设置分层学习,使学生在学习过程中不至于产生厌学感,让所有学生都能尝到学习程序设计的乐趣。 师生共同完成主要程序的编写(电子板书三);学生自行设计界面,老师引导并进行巡视辅

文档评论(0)

小教资源库 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档